name: Publish Docker Images on: workflow_call: inputs: JAVA_VERSION: description: Java version to use required: false type: string default: '17' PROJECT_VERSION: description: Branch reference required: true type: string PROJECT_NAME: description: Project name required: true type: string secrets: CI_BOT_USERNAME: required: true CI_BOT_TOKEN: required: true jobs: publish-artifact: runs-on: ubuntu-latest steps: - name: Set git credentials if: needs.release.outputs.has-changes == 'true' run: | echo "A: ${{ vars.BOT_NAME }}" echo "B: ${{ vars.BOT_EMAIL }}" echo "C: ${{ vars.JAVA_VERSION }}" echo "D: ${{ vars.PROJECT_VERSION }}" echo "E: ${{ vars.PROJECT_NAME }}" echo "F: ${{ vars.CI_BOT_USERNAME }}"